“Grandpa, do I really need my own car?” Maria looked at her grandfather as they drove down Military Hwy.
Ever since Maria told her grandparents about winning the lottery at the surprise dinner Vincent made for them, she informed them that she would split the winnings with Vincent and that she was in the process of buying Cain Electronics from Mr. Cain. Mr. Cain put her in contact with the owner of Priest Electronics, who was willing to sell Priest Electronics to Mr. Cain.
Priest Electronics was a smaller store and catered to the DIY (Do It Yourself) crowd. The owner, Mr. Thomas Green, just wanted to get out of the business. He opened his store around the same time Mr. Cain did. The lawyer she hired to handle all the legal stuff for both stores. She was in contact with the owner of the apartment she and Vincent lived in, offering to sell her the three buildings and the other apartment building with twenty-six units off forty-fifth street.
“Maria, you’re going to need your own vehicle if you’re going to own property. That way, you can go and inspect your properties.” Ralph glances at Maria as she sits next to him.
“If you say so, grandpa.” Maria watches as her grandfather turns off Military Hwy and onto Virginia Beach Blvd.
She hasn’t been this far into Virginia Beach since she was fifteen years old. Her high school had gone on a field trip. She spots the place her grandfather was taking her to look at cars.
Ralph pulls into the car lot and parks. He spots his friend Willie coming out of the building, wearing a nice business shirt, a necktie, and dress pants, with a huge smile on his face. Maria exits the truck on the passenger side.
“Ralph, it’s good to see you.” Willie walks over to shake Ralph’s hand.
Ralph shakes Willie’s hand. “I would like you to meet my granddaughter, Maria. She’s looking to buy her first car.”
Willie looks at Maria and extends his hand to her. “It’s nice to meet you, Maria.”
“And you as well, Willie.” Marie shakes his hand.
“So, tell me. What type of car are you looking for?” Willie watches Maria’s facial expression.
“Well, I would like a car or SUV that gets good gas mileage, and isn’t a pain to maintain.” Maria knew her grandfather would want her to learn to change her own oil and handle her regular maintenance.
“Let me show you around, and see if we can’t find the perfect car for you.” Willie leads Maria and Ralph over to the nearest SUV.
Ralph and Maria follow Willie. She knew that if Willie were a friend of her grandfather, she’d get a good price on a vehicle. For the next hour and a half, and several test drives later.
“This is the one, Grandpa.” Maria liked the black 2024 Honda CR-V Sport-L she just finished test-driving.
Ralph looks at Willie, “How much is it, Willie?”
“Let’s see, are you financing it or buying it outright?” Willie looks at Ralph and Maria.
“Buying outright,” Maria answers Willie's question.
Willie had to think about how much the lot contained and how much his commission would be. “Well, since we are good friends, Ralph. How about thirty thousand dollars?”
Maria looks towards her grandpa to see what he thinks. This was all new to Maria. She had never bought a car before.
Ralph noticed Marie looking at him. They have spent the last hour and a half looking at vehicles and test-driving them.
“Does this vehicle come with a warranty?”
“Yes. Five years or one hundred fifty miles, whichever comes first. Plus, the warranty covers the hybrid battery, free inspections as long as they are done here, and scheduled maintenance is covered.”
“Sounds good.” Ralph looks at Maria.
“Okay, let’s sign all the necessary paperwork.”
An hour later, Maria is sitting in her new SUV, following her grandfather back to his place. She can’t wait to see what her grandmother thinks about her buying the SUV. She has to go check out the apartment building on forty-fifth street tomorrow and decide whether she wants to buy it.
Later in the evening, Maria arrives back home and parks her new SUV in her assigned parking space. She doesn’t spot Vincent’s car anywhere in the lot. She gets out and heads up to her apartment.
She notices she has the apartment to herself. She hopes Vincent is alright. She strips out of her clothes and takes a nice, long, hot shower. She couldn’t believe she just bought her very first car. She has never wanted to own a vehicle before, because her work wasn’t that far away and it was on the bus line.
After Maria finishes her shower, she heads into her bedroom and puts on her favorite nightshirt, but no panties. She looks up the property that the current owner owns and reviews the posted pictures.
After examining it for a while, Maria powers off her computer and lies down on her bed.
